Deliveries to Escrow Agent. A Security Holder who wishes to tender Securities (the “Tendered Securities”) to a bona fide formal take-over bid, plan of arrangement, amalgamation, merger or similar transaction (a “Transaction”) shall deliver to the Escrow Agent: (a) a written direction signed by the Security Holder (a “Direction”) that directs the Escrow Agent to deliver to a specified person (the “Depositary”) either: (i) certificates evidencing the Tendered Securities; or (ii) where the Security Holder has provided the Escrow Agent with a notice of guaranteed delivery or similar notice of the Security Holder's intent to tender the Tendered Securities to the Transaction, that notice; (b) a letter of transmittal or similar document; (c) where required, a transfer power of attorney duly executed by the transferor; (d) the written consent of the Exchange; (e) any other documentation required to be delivered to the Depositary under the terms of the Transaction; and (f) such other information concerning or evidence of the Transaction that the Escrow Agent may reasonably require.

Deliveries to Escrow Agent. 1.1 The Escrow Agent shall receive, hold and preserve the Transponder Documents in as safe and secure a manner as possible, appropriate for valuable assets similar in nature to the Production File - in a separate container, appropriately segregated from materials that do not form part of the subject matter of this Agreement at a location in the State of Israel to be mutually agreed upon by Telematics and Derech Eretz with access only by such employees of the Escrow Agent as are duly authorized by the Escrow Agent from time to time, and for disposition only in accordance with the provisions of this Agreement. The Escrow Agent shall have no beneficial rights in the Transponder Documents. 1.2 The Escrow Agent recognizes and agrees that the materials contained in the Transponder Documents are the valuable assets and proprietary and confidential information of Telematics and may be required under the terms hereof by Derech Eretz as contemplated by this Agreement. Further, the Escrow Agent agrees to hold the Transponder Documents in strictest confidence and take all appropriate acts to maintain their confidentiality. The Escrow Agent agrees that it will not use, copy or disclose the Transponder Documents to any person, in any manner whatsoever, except as expressly provided for herein. 1.3 For the avoidance of doubt, the Transponder Documents will include: product tree, flow charts, electrical drawings, mechanical and layout drawings, electrical harnesses and wiring drawings, gerber files for printed circuit boards, assembly instructions and drawings, parts and vendors list, test setup and procedures, executable software files, programming instructions for firmware (ASIC and any other programming devices), specifications for special components, authorization letter assignment for the direct procurement of standard and special components.
